static void colorband_init_from_table_rgba_simple(
ColorBand *coba,
const float (*array)[4], const int array_len)
{
/* No Re-sample, just de-duplicate. */
const float eps = (1.0f / 255.0f) + 1e-6f;
BLI_assert(array_len < MAXCOLORBAND);
int stops = min_ii(MAXCOLORBAND, array_len);
if (stops) {
const float step_size = 1.0f / (float)max_ii(stops - 1, 1);
int i_curr = -1;
for (int i_step = 0; i_step < stops; i_step++) {
if ((i_curr != -1) && compare_v4v4(&coba->data[i_curr].r, array[i_step], eps)) {
continue;
}
i_curr += 1;
copy_v4_v4(&coba->data[i_curr].r, array[i_step]);
coba->data[i_curr].pos = i_step * step_size;
coba->data[i_curr].cur = i_curr;
}
coba->tot = i_curr + 1;
coba->cur = 0;
}
else {
/* coba is empty, set 1 black stop */
zero_v3(&coba->data[0].r);
coba->data[0].a = 1.0f;
coba->cur = 0;
coba->tot = 1;
}
}
static void colorband_init_from_table_rgba_resample(
ColorBand *coba,
const float (*array)[4], const int array_len)
{
/* TODO: more optimal method of color simplification,
* for now just pick evenly spaced colors. */
BLI_assert(array_len >= MAXCOLORBAND);
float step = array_len / (float)MAXCOLORBAND;
float color_step = 1.0f / (MAXCOLORBAND - 1);
for (int i = 0; i < MAXCOLORBAND; i++) {
int cur_color = (int)(step * i);
copy_v4_v4(&coba->data[i].r, array[cur_color]);
coba->data[i].pos = i * color_step;
coba->data[i].cur = i;
}
coba->tot = MAXCOLORBAND;
coba->cur = 0;
}
void BKE_colorband_init_from_table_rgba(
ColorBand *coba,
const float (*array)[4], const int array_len)
{
if (array_len < MAXCOLORBAND) {
/* No Re-sample, just de-duplicate. */
colorband_init_from_table_rgba_simple(coba, array, array_len);
}
else {
/* Re-sample */
colorband_init_from_table_rgba_resample(coba, array, array_len);
}
}

/* -------------------------------------------------------------------- */
/** \name Eyedropper (RGB Color Band)
*
* Operates by either:
* - Dragging a straight line, sampling pixels formed by the line to extract a gradient.
* - Clicking on points, adding each color to the end of the color-band.
* \{ */
typedef struct Colorband_RNAUpdateCb {
PointerRNA ptr;
PropertyRNA *prop;
} Colorband_RNAUpdateCb;
typedef struct EyedropperColorband {
int last_x, last_y;
/* Alpha is currently fixed at 1.0, may support in future. */
float (*color_buffer)[4];
int color_buffer_alloc;
int color_buffer_len;
bool sample_start;
ColorBand init_color_band;
ColorBand *color_band;
PointerRNA ptr;
PropertyRNA *prop;
} EyedropperColorband;
/* For user-data only. */
struct EyedropperColorband_Context {
bContext *context;
EyedropperColorband *eye;
};
static bool eyedropper_colorband_init(bContext *C, wmOperator *op)
{
ColorBand *band = NULL;
EyedropperColorband *eye;
uiBut *but = UI_context_active_but_get(C);
if (but == NULL) {
/* pass */
}
else if (but->type == UI_BTYPE_COLORBAND) {
/* When invoked with a hotkey, we can find the band in 'but->poin'. */
band = (ColorBand *)but->poin;
}
else {
/* When invoked from a button it's in custom_data field. */
band = (ColorBand *)but->custom_data;
}
if (!band)
return false;
op->customdata = eye = MEM_callocN(sizeof(EyedropperColorband), __func__);
eye->color_buffer_alloc = 16;
eye->color_buffer = MEM_mallocN(sizeof(*eye->color_buffer) * eye->color_buffer_alloc, __func__);
eye->color_buffer_len = 0;
eye->color_band = band;
eye->init_color_band = *eye->color_band;
eye->ptr = ((Colorband_RNAUpdateCb *)but->func_argN)->ptr;
eye->prop = ((Colorband_RNAUpdateCb *)but->func_argN)->prop;
return true;
}
static void eyedropper_colorband_sample_point(bContext *C, EyedropperColorband *eye, int mx, int my)
{
if (eye->last_x != mx || eye->last_y != my) {
float col[4];
col[3] = 1.0f; /* TODO: sample alpha */
eyedropper_color_sample_fl(C, mx, my, col);
if (eye->color_buffer_len + 1 == eye->color_buffer_alloc) {
eye->color_buffer_alloc *= 2;
eye->color_buffer = MEM_reallocN(eye->color_buffer, sizeof(*eye->color_buffer) * eye->color_buffer_alloc);
}
copy_v4_v4(eye->color_buffer[eye->color_buffer_len], col);
eye->color_buffer_len += 1;
eye->last_x = mx;
eye->last_y = my;
}
}
static bool eyedropper_colorband_sample_callback(int mx, int my, void *userdata)
{
struct EyedropperColorband_Context *data = userdata;
bContext *C = data->context;
EyedropperColorband *eye = data->eye;
eyedropper_colorband_sample_point(C, eye, mx, my);
return true;
}
static void eyedropper_colorband_sample_segment(bContext *C, EyedropperColorband *eye, int mx, int my)
{
/* Since the mouse tends to move rather rapidly we use #BLI_bitmap_draw_2d_line_v2v2i
* to interpolate between the reported coordinates */
struct EyedropperColorband_Context userdata = {C, eye};
int p1[2] = {eye->last_x, eye->last_y};
int p2[2] = {mx, my};
BLI_bitmap_draw_2d_line_v2v2i(p1, p2, eyedropper_colorband_sample_callback, &userdata);
}
static void eyedropper_colorband_exit(bContext *C, wmOperator *op)
{
WM_cursor_modal_restore(CTX_wm_window(C));
if (op->customdata) {
EyedropperColorband *eye = op->customdata;
MEM_freeN(eye->color_buffer);
MEM_freeN(eye);
op->customdata = NULL;
}
}
static void eyedropper_colorband_apply(bContext *C, wmOperator *op)
{
EyedropperColorband *eye = op->customdata;
BKE_colorband_init_from_table_rgba(eye->color_band, eye->color_buffer, eye->color_buffer_len);
RNA_property_update(C, &eye->ptr, eye->prop);
}
static void eyedropper_colorband_cancel(bContext *C, wmOperator *op)
{
EyedropperColorband *eye = op->customdata;
*eye->color_band = eye->init_color_band;
RNA_property_update(C, &eye->ptr, eye->prop);
eyedropper_colorband_exit(C, op);
}
